Brant County OPP were called by an employee from Ply Gem Building Products after $100 worth of copper wire was stolen.
Police are investigating a report of theft in Brant County.
Brant County OPP responded to a call from an employee from Ply Gem Building Products on October 4th after copper wire was reported stolen on September 29th.
The surveillance footage shows an unknown male cutting the fence around a hydro transformer and then removing 3 feet of copper wire. The suspect was wearing a bright coloured reflective orange jacket with a black baseball cap.
The theft is valued at $100.
If anyone has more information, contact Brant County OPP at 1-888-310-1122.
